当前位置: 代码迷 >> 热门搜索 >> java 集合 序列化
 

java 集合 序列化

  • 经过byte数组简单分析Java序列化、Kryo、ProtoBuf序列化

    透过byte数组简单分析Java序列化、Kryo、ProtoBuf序列化序列化在高性能网络编程、分布式系统开发中是举足轻重的之前有用过Java序列化、ProtocolBuffer等,在这篇文章这里中简单分析序列化后的byte数组观察各种序列化的差异与性能,这里主要分析Java序列化、Kryo、ProtocolBuffer序列化;Java序列化为jdk自带的序列化实现,不需要依赖任何包;Kryo为高...

    58
    热度
  • Java中的JSON序列化跟反序列化

    Java中的JSON序列化和反序列化 每次写代码遇到问题的时候,google后总是先找javaeye里给出的答案,比较权威,比较专业,而且通常问题可以很快的解决。这两天在写一个.net客户端和java服务器端通过json报文,使用Mina框架通信的项目,为了减少编写代码的重复性,写了几个使用反射来通过函数名称调用该函数,以及Json序列化和反序列化的程序,现在想总结记录一下。1.Java中的JS...

    1079
    热度
  • Spark / Java:不可序列化问题-Kryo序列化

    问题描述 我对kryo序列化缺少什么? Class1和Class3不是Java可序列化的类(没有默认构造函数,没有getter和setter) 当我尝试“使用”实例时,该实例是在Spark内部通过Spark上下文创建的,无论是否将Classe3注册为Kryo类,都会遇到序列化问题。 工作正常: Dataset<Class1>ds=spark.createDataset(clas...

    73
    热度
  • 又是对象流,对象中有对象属性,小弟我怎么序列化保存它

    又是对象流,对象中有对象属性,我如何序列化保存它[code=JScrip]publicclassUserimplementsSerializable{ privateStringusername; privateStringpass; privateList<Contact>list=newArrayList<Contact>();//Contact是一个类[/code][...

    10430
    热度
  • java序列化有关问题

    java序列化问题各位大侠,请问,如果一个类声明为可序列化类,而它其中一个属性是不可序列化的,请问序列化该类时,那个属性如何处理?比如:类A其中包含一个属性,publicBb,其中类B是不可序列化的。多谢指教color='#e78608'>------解决方案--------------------申明为transientcolor='#e78608'>------解决方案------------...

    74
    热度
  • java 序列化的有关问题

    java序列化的问题序列化后的一个文件,想先读取最后一个对象,这样有办法实现吗?必须从头开始吗?color='#e78608'>------解决方案--------------------这个无法做到,java的序列化之后反序列化只能是按照之前保存的顺序加入你想要直接读取最后一个对象,那你直接将最后一个对象单独再放入一个文件里面吧,何必都窝在一个文件color='#e78608'>------解决...

    225
    热度
  • 求教:java序列化和反序列化解决思路

    求教:java序列化和反序列化请问什么是java序列化和反序列化;这2个一般在企业开发中用来做什么,这样做有啥好处color='#FF8000'>------解决方案--------------------数据存储,参考这个,,color='#FF8000'>------解决方案--------------------同意楼上,很早以前的技术了。现在发展到了:为了快速开发方便解析而用的json格式...

    23
    热度
  • java序列化,该如何解决

    java的序列化总是看到java的某些类需要序列化,这是什么意思?干什么用的?color='#e78608'>------解决方案--------------------序列化的过程就是对象写入字节流和从字节流中读取对象。将对象状态转换成字节流之后,可以用java.io包中的各种字节流类将其保存到文件中,管道到另一线程中或通过网络连接将对象数据发送到另一主机。对象序列化功能非常简单、强大,在RMI...

    23
    热度
  • JSON HashMap反序列化

    问题描述 我想反序列化此JSON“{\\”m\\“:{\\”Test\\“:{\\”nombre\\“:\\”jose\\“,\\”apellidos\\“:\\”jose\\“,\\”edad\\“:30}}}”连接到PersonaContainer。 publicclassPersona{ privateStringnombre; privateStringapellidos; privat...

    7
    热度
  • 关于JAVA的对象序列化,为何要序列化

    关于JAVA的对象序列化,为什么要序列化? ???简单来说序列化就是一种用来处理对象流的机制,所谓对象流也就是将对象的内容进行流化,流的概念这里不用多说(就是I/O),我们可以对流化后的对象进行读写操作,也可将流化后的对象传输于网络之间(注:要想将对象传输于网络必须进行流化)!在对对象流进行读写操作时会引发一些问题,而序列化机制正是用来解决这些问题的!???????????如上所述,读写对象会有什...

    789
    热度
  • java锁与序列化的关系 欢迎议论

    java锁与序列化的关系欢迎讨论看java编程思想上有这么一句话基本上所有并发模式在解决线程冲突的时候,都是采用序列化共享资源的方案。我实在不解,java中对象序列化主要是为了实现分布式(可能我说法不准确),怎么会跟锁扯上关系呢,我google了下,发现网上都是引用这句话的没有说为什么,希望大牛们解答下或者讨论下。color='#e78608'>------解决方案----------------...

    73
    热度
  • fastjson序列化hibernate代理和延迟加载对象出现no session错误的解决方法

    fastjson序列化hibernate代理和延迟加载对象出现nosession异常的解决办法fastjson序列化hibernate代理和延迟加载对象出现org.hibernate.LazyInitializationException:failedtolazilyinitializeacollectionofrole:com.eecn.warehouse.api.model.Tags.chil...

    1414
    热度
  • Android 施用Parcelable序列化对象

    Android使用Parcelable序列化对象Android序列化对象主要有两种方法,实现Serializable接口、或者实现Parcelable接口。实现Serializable接口是JavaSE本身就支持的,而Parcelable是Android特有的功能,效率比实现Serializable接口高,而且还可以用在IPC中。实现Serializable接口非常简单,声明一下就可以了,而实现P...

    85
    热度
  • Android bit地图序列化

    Androidbitmap序列化java"name="code">importjava.io.ByteArrayOutputStream;importandroid.graphics.Bitmap;importandroid.graphics.BitmapFactory;importandroid.graphics.Bitmap.CompressFormat;importandroid.os.Pa...

    65
    热度
  • 关于对象序列化的有关问题(path不可序列化?)

    关于对象序列化的问题(path不可序列化?)我的类实现如下JavacodeclassMyDataimplementsSerializable{intflag;//设置颜色publicfloat[]line_strt_x;publicfloat[]line_strt_y;publicfloat[]line_end_x;publicfloat[]line_end_y;publicintpoint01_...

    102
    热度
  • 集合--Collection集合

    场景当数据多了要进行存储时,需要一个容器,存储固定长度的数据可以使用数组。但是如果数据的个数不确定,再使用数组就较为繁杂。Java就引入了另外一个可变的容器----集合在1.2版本之后,随着功能和需求的增多,将其不同种类的共性向上抽取,形成了体系,就出现了集合框架,有了更多种类的集合容器,用来完成不同的需求。这些集合容器是通过数据结构(存储数据的一种方式)来进行区分。集合框架的最顶层是一个接口co...

    80
    热度
  • java序列化的1点经验

    java序列化的一点经验 java序列化的一点经验半年多一来,一直碰到一个问题没有解决,就是当web应用和EJB分开部署,web再调用EJB时web一直报错,而且是系统错误,找不到原因。半年后,又再次碰到这个问题,正好现在有时间好好研究了一下。终于发现是当有DTO作为对象传递给EJB时,报的错误。我的DTO已经implementsjava.io.Serializable了,可是服务器还是报错:cl...

    913
    热度
  • 如何反序列化EnumMap

    问题描述 我正在试图弄清楚如何反序列化EnumMap。 到目前为止,我一直在使用Gson库来获取其他所有内容并且已经成功。 这证明是困难的。 这是一个基本想法: importjava.lang.reflect.Type; importcom.google.gson.reflect.TypeToken; importcom.google.gson.Gson; enumFRUIT{ APPLE,...

    31
    热度
  • Java中的可序列化

    Java中的可序列化类 请问java中的可序类化类应该怎么用,最好举个例子。如果有个demo最好了~v~! 搜索更多相关主题的帖子: color="red">序列color="red">Java color='#FF8000'>----------------解决方案---------------------...

    857
    热度
  • 深度分析 Java 的枚举类型:枚举的线程安全性及序列化有关问题

    深度分析Java的枚举类型:枚举的线程安全性及序列化问题写在前面:JavaSE5提供了一种新的类型Java的枚举类型,关键字enum可以将一组具名的值的有限集合创建为一种新的类型,而这些具名的值可以作为常规的程序组件使用,这是一种非常有用的功能。本文将深入分析枚举的源码,看一看枚举是怎么实现的,是如何保证线程安全的,以及为什么用枚举实现的单例是最佳方式。枚举是如何保证线程安全的要想看源码,首先得有...

    31
    热度